Pepi Umathum is one of Austria's best known producers. In the Burgenland growing district called Neusiedlersee (Lake Neusiedl), he counts as one of the great champions of the traditional Austrian grape varieties. His main holdings are Rotburger (Zweigelt), St Laurent and Blaufrankisch with a bit of Welschriesling, Roter Traminer, the extremely rare Gelber Traminer, and the unusual ancient Lindenblattriger (Harslevelu in Hungary).
Pepi has embraced the intricacies and harmonies of biodynamic viticulture, and for most of his wines, which are all hand-harvested, he prefers to use large barrels of native Austrian oak, which underscores the clear fruit aromatics of the wines. Some of the high-toned single vineyard bottlings are matured in smaller oak barrels and barriques, and are first released three years after the vintage.

Ntsiki Biyela is one of South Africa's most celebrated winemakers — the first Black woman to earn a winemaking degree in South Africa, and the founder of Aslina Wines, named in honor of her grandmother. Her Stellenbosch Cabernet Sauvignon is a wine of genuine character: bold, structured, and deeply expressive of the Cape's finest red wine appellation.

Bodegas Gomez Cruzado is one of Rioja's most exciting modern producers — a historic estate in Haro, the heart of Rioja Alta, that has undergone a remarkable transformation under the direction of winemaker Amanda Klemp, who has brought a precision-focused, terroir-driven approach to the cellar while honoring the estate's deep roots in the region. El Predilecto — "The Favorite" — is a total departure from the Rioja norm: a blend of old vine Garnacha and Tempranillo sourced from two distinct mountain landscapes, united in concrete and crafted to express the full complexity of Rioja's diverse terroir. The Garnacha (65%) comes from Alto Najerilla, in the triangle formed by the towns of Badarán, Cordovín, and Cárdenas in the Sierra Demanda mountains. The Tempranillo (35%) comes from the highest area of Samaniego, near the Sierra Cantabria mountains. Old vines at the foot of both mountain ranges provide greater fruit character and concentration. Fermented separately with native yeast, 100% destemmed without crushing, cold fermented with short maceration, then blended and refined in concrete for approximately five months — a winemaking approach that preserves freshness, precision, and the distinct personality of each site.

Overall goals and philosophy of wine: Syrah is a beguiling grape with many expressions in the vinous world, from the gamey classics of France to the inkiness of Australia. In the Finger Lakes, it takes a special site to nurture these beautiful vines to full maturity, but in Glacier Ridge we have found just such a vineyard. With intense Vietnamese peppercorn aromatics, bright red cherry flavors, and a brooding minerality underneath, this Syrah is a pure expression of what can be achieved with one of our favorite grapes in a cool climate. Put simply, think northern Rhone rather than Barossa.
Notable vineyard management details: Glacier Ridge takes a studied minimalist approach in the vineyard; all weed control is manual and allows for some non-grape vegetation for competition as well as insect biodiversity. Crop size are subsequently lower as a result, with a notable difference in increased ripening capability of the grapes.

Milan Nestarec Youngster Red is a red natural wine made from a blend of Zweigelt, Cabernet Sauvignon, and Dornfelder. The grapes are hand-harvested and destemmed. The juice ferments in 2000-liter stainless steel tanks. The wine ferments for about 2 months, with occasional pigeage and indigenous yeast fermentation. Elevage takes place in the same tanks for about 2 months. The wine is bottled unfiltered, unfined, and with zero sulfur added.

Antídoto comes from the far eastern reaches of Ribera del Duero — the Soria province, a wilder, less-traveled corner of the appellation where the rules are looser and the vineyards are older. Bertrand Sourdais and David Hernando work with up to 400 different parcels of old, ungrafted Tempranillo (Tinto Fino) vines rooted in a patchwork of limestone, decomposed granite, and clay. The project is biodynamic and organic in spirit, with spontaneous fermentation, no fining, no filtering, and minimal intervention throughout.
The 2024 vintage is a more delicate, fine-boned expression than prior years — fermented in stainless steel with indigenous yeasts, then aged nine months in 600-liter French oak barrels (25% new). This small winery is the project of Sandrino Quadraroli, the owner of one of the finest restaurants in central Marche, Osteria del Borgia. Always a champion of the wines of his region, starting in 2012 he was finally able to crown his dream of producing wine.
The 4 hectares estate was planted in 1999, upside down Guyot system, on clay, sandy and calcareous soil 500 meters above sea level on the south-facing hills right above lake Caccamo in the township of Serrapetrona located in the mountainous central part of the Marche region.
The focus of the winery is the grape varietal indigenous to this sub-region: Vernaccia Nera, not found anywhere else in the world. This grape has a long history, however it was traditionally vinified sparkling and semi-sweet, possibly in order to tame the bold characteristics that this varietal has: crushed white and black pepper. Over the past two decades or so, a new generation of wineries in the area is concentrating on exalting the unique character of Vernaccia Nera and are bottling still, dry wines. The results are fascinating: the wines are distinctive, aromatic, full-bodied but elegant and vibrant, with good minerality and refreshing acidity.
